Gay marriage bill hits major snag in Md.

Published March 11, 2011 5:00am ET



The Maryland House of Delegates sent a landmark bill to allow gay marriage back to committee Friday afternoon, effectively killing the measure unless supporters can scrap together enough votes.

The House debated for two hours on Friday, but did not vote on the measure, as had been planned.

“We just didn’t have the votes. It was heartbreakingly close,” said state Sen. Jamie Raskin, D-Silver Spring.
